Describe the steps used to filter a mixture of sand and water​
Ahat [919]

Answer:

Place a filter funnel on the top of a conical flask.

Roll the filter paper into a cone and place it on the flask.

Pour the mixture of sand and water into the conical flask with the filter funnel and paper.

Wait till all the sand is left over in the filter paper and all the water has been separated.

(You could also heat the sand in a warm oven to remove any water remaining)

The amount of energy that is transferred at each level of the food chain is about _____. 1% 10% 50% 90%
Sloan [31]
The amount of energy that is transferred at each level of the food chain is about 10%. This is called the 10% rule (10 per cent rule).
